Four Steps to Prepare a Product Review

Let’s first get one thing straight: valuable product reviews come from real-life experiences and knowledge. Before writing your review, you need to understand the product inside and out, identify who it’s best for, spot gaps in existing reviews, and organize your insights effectively. Let’s explore the steps you need to take before writing a product review.

1. Test the product first-hand

Testing products yourself is essential because people trust real experiences, not summaries of other reviews. Every detail you discover during testing helps build a complete picture of the product’s true value and makes your review authentic. When testing a product, pay attention to:

  • First impressions
  • Basic features
  • Quality
  • Special features
  • Real problems

It’s also important to systematically document your testing journey. Your initial product impressions might change over time, and keeping notes of such shifts makes your review more comprehensive and trustworthy.

2. Define the product’s target market

After testing the product, use your experience along with pricing and marketing research to determine its target users. This helps you write reviews that match specific reader needs with product benefits. Analyze these key areas:

  • Test results vs marketing
  • Price vs features
  • Unexpected uses

Once you’ve made all these notes, put together a user profile of the people who would benefit most from the product you’re testing. Consider demographics like age and income level, technical proficiency, lifestyle factors like personal interests, and specific needs – the problems they’re trying to solve.

3. Check for content gaps in existing reviews

Before writing your review, check how others have covered the same product. This research helps you spot what’s missing and where you can add unique value or a fresh perspective. Visit review sites, platforms like Reddit and Quora, blogs, and YouTube channels covering the same product, and pay attention to:

  • Questions in comments that go unanswered
  • Missing real-world scenarios
  • Skipped features or settings that could be important
  • Lack of long-term usage feedback
  • Missing comparisons with specific alternatives

Similarly, you can highlight features that fulfill specific demands.

How to Write an Impactful Product Review

You’ve done the testing, research, and planning. Now comes the key part – writing your review. Let’s look at how to turn your ideas into a review that’s engaging, helpful, and stands out from the generic content out there. Below we’ll cover the core steps like writing headlines that grab attention, crafting introductions, describing the product’s pros and cons, and adding visual elements.

1. Start with an attention-grabbing headline

Start with writing an engaging, specific, and relevant headline for your review. It’ll determine whether readers will click through to your review or scroll past it. To get it right, brainstorm a few headline ideas upfront, then refine and choose the best one once your review is complete.

Here’s how you can make your product review headlines more effective:

  • Be specific about the focus of your review
  • Feature key findings
  • Include real-world evidence from testing
  • Focus on practical insights
  • Highlight important details

2. Write an engaging introduction

Next, write your introduction. The opening section helps you quickly establish trust and show readers you understand their needs. A compelling intro makes readers think “This person gets my situation.” Use these tips for writing engaging introductions:

  • Share a relatable experience
  • Address common frustrations
  • Establish testing credibility
  • Be specific about your journey
  • Show what’s at stake

3. Share key features of the product

Next, provide an overview of the product’s core functionalities. This helps readers understand what they’re getting and why it matters to them. While manufacturers love to highlight technical specifications, your job is to translate these numbers into real value for readers. Take power banks – instead of simply mentioning the “24,000-mAh capacity and 140W charging,” explain that the device charges laptops and phones simultaneously and refills its own battery within an hour. Most importantly, connect these features to your hands-on experience to reveal the true story behind each feature.

4. Share your experience and analysis

Next, describe your testing methodology and experience to build credibility for your product review. Break down your evaluation process in detail and mention:

  • Duration of testing, in hours, days, or months
  • Specific usage scenarios and conditions
  • Any variables that might affect performance
  • Your relevant background or expertise
  • What do you compare it against
  • Testing environment and circumstances

5. Focus on the product’s benefits

You will also need to explain how the product solves specific pain points for the target users. While you’ve already tested the product and identified its key features, this step lets you dig deeper into the real value it offers. Here’s what you should consider:

  • Explain what problem the product solves
  • Show why it stands out
  • Connect benefits to specific users
  • Highlight long-term value

6. Provide honest pros and cons of the product

The pros and cons section is pretty much the golden standard of product reviews. Many readers skip directly to it to quickly assess a product’s value. When writing the pros and cons section, be honest. Highlight what the product does well, but also mention any downsides or limitations. Use bullet points for easy reading.

7. Provide visual elements

Adding original images or videos to your product review page is another step that helps you build credibility and engagement. It also improves the overall user experience with your content and facilitates reading. Here’s what you can capture:

  • Show the product in use
  • Highlight key features
  • Compare before and after results
  • Include different angles or settings

8. Provide a comparison to similar products and offer your opinion

Finally, comparing the product to similar options helps readers understand if it’s the right choice or if something else might work better for their needs. When making such comparisons, consider:

  • Key differences in features
  • Price vs. value
  • Performance and user experience
  • Target audience fit

How to Write a Product Review FAQ

How long should a product review be?

There’s no ideal content length for a product review. Instead, focus on making it long enough to cover key details without losing the reader’s interest. For simple products, 800–1,500 words could be enough enough. For more complex products, 2,000+ words may be necessary to include in-depth testing, comparisons, and long-term insights.

How can I make my product review more engaging?

You can make your product review pop by removing generic content and adding a personal touch. Weave in real stories, throw in some unexpected insights, and make readers feel like they’re getting the inside scoop. It’s also important to make it easy and enjoyable to read by adding detailed sections, bullet points, and useful images. The goal? Making your review feel authentic and practical right away.

What key points should I include in my review?

A strong product review should cover who the product is for, its main features, pros and cons, and how it compares to alternatives. Include first-hand testing insights, real-world performance reviews, and potential downsides. If relevant, mention pricing, long-term durability, and any limitations. Then, summarize it all with a final verdict or recommendation to help readers make a decision.
